Output 4c55a690963fab3b99a457b5363a6bf4da5561508230332c2079c11b1dfc11fe:3

value
27969532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 235d21e1ed25074112cadba9c8975c16748f3d8b OP_EQUAL
address
34v19CyF5ZGvY8tPer1Cua6bfYK24wGXcy
transaction
4c55a690963fab3b99a457b5363a6bf4da5561508230332c2079c11b1dfc11fe
confirmations
418896
spent
true